The cheapest way to get from Mölndal to Åby Arenastad is to line 753 bus which costs 5 kr - 19 kr and takes 7 min.
The fastest way to get from Mölndal to Åby Arenastad is to taxi which takes 3 min and costs 70 kr - 90 kr.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Mölndals bro and arriving at Åby Arenastad. Services depart every 20 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 7 min.
The distance between Mölndal and Åby Arenastad is 5 km.
The best way to get from Mölndal to Åby Arenastad without a car is to line 753 bus which takes 7 min and costs 5 kr - 19 kr.
The line 753 bus from Mölndals bro to Åby Arenastad takes 7 min including transfers and departs every 20 minutes.
